Addiction to Technological Gadgets and Its Impact on Health and Lifestyle: A Study on College Students Abstract In the present era the introduction of modern technological gadgets has captured the attention of global population. The dependency of people on these technological gadgets and services provided by these has reached at such level that, without these, they can't think a step forward in the direction of their growth. The degree of dependency is leading to addiction of the tech-devices and services. Youth is the most vulnerable group among the population to be addicted to technology. The study was designed to examine the use of tech-devices by youth i.e. the time spent with the gadgets, the purposes behind use, and its impacts on mental health and life style. Using structured questionnaire, unstructured interviews and observation by the researcher, primary data were collected from 150 respondents of NIT, Rourkela. Findings of the study showed that most of the young respondents spend a large amount of their time with their tech-gadgets and services provided by them. The purposes of use i n most cases are pleasure driven rather than necessity driven. Again, it reveals that addiction to tech-devices has many negative impacts on the aspects relating to mental health of the respondents and has become a causal factor in the change of life style of young participants. The results are interpreted based on the current theories and implications for future are pointed out.
